eighteen million, nine hundred ninety-two thousand, seven hundred eighty-seven
Currency CA$18992787 in canadian english: eighteen million, nine hundred ninety-two thousand, seven hundred eighty-seven Canadian dollar.
In Price: 18992787.00
17992787 | 19992787